php输入人数控制表格,如何使用PHP处理动态数量的表单输入?

嗨,我有一个表格,用户可以选择开始日期和结束日期.例如,当天数为3时,将生成3行日期.每个日期,日期和时段(上午/下午)将存储在隐藏字段中.因此,3天将生成名为date_1,day_1,period_1,date_2,day_2,period_2,date_3,day_3,period_3的隐藏字段.

问题是如何处理这种动态数量的表单输入?我需要将值传递给控制器​​,然后建模以存储到数据库中.这是主要的问题,因为表单输入是数字是动态的,我们需要将它传递给控制器​​函数.

有人能告诉我处理这个问题的正确方法吗?教程的链接将有所帮助谢谢:)

这是用于生成日期列表的代码,如下图所示

function test(){

var count = 0;

var date1 = $('#alternatestartdate').val();

var date2 = $('#alternateenddate').val();

var startDate = new Date(date1);

var endDate = new Date(date2);

var Weekday = new Array("Sunday","Monday","Tuesday","Wednesday","Thursday","Friday","Saturday");

while (startDate<=endDate)

{

var weekDay = startDate.getDay();

if (weekDay < 6 && weekDay > 0) {

var month = startDate.getMonth()+1;

if( month <= 9 ) { month = "0"+month; }

var day = startDate.getDate();

var datearr = new Array();

if( day <= 9 ) { day = "0"+day; }

count++;

var datelist = day+"-"+month+"-"+startDate.getFullYear();

$('#pa').append(day+"-"+month+"-"+startDate.getFullYear() + " ("+Weekday[weekDay]+") FullHalf (AM)Half (PM)
");

}

startDate.setDate(startDate.getDate()+1)

}

$('#pa').append("");

}

如果正确插入,数据库中的数据将如下所示:

  • 0
    点赞
  • 0
    收藏
    觉得还不错? 一键收藏
  • 0
    评论
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值